The Event Booking Manager for WooCommerce WordPress plugin before 5.3.7 does not prevent the deserialization of user-controlled input in some of its event content fields, allowing users with Contributor-level access and above to inject PHP objects. No POP chain is present in the Event Booking Manager for WooCommerce WordPress plugin before 5.3.7 itself, but if one is present via another installed Event Booking Manager for WooCommerce WordPress plugin before 5.3.7 or , this could lead to actions such as arbitrary file deletion, sensitive data retrieval, or remote code execution. This is an incomplete fix of the Event Booking Manager for WooCommerce WordPress plugin before 5.3.7's earlier object-injection advisories.
